Stella McCartney – New Collection For Gap Kids
Stella McCartney launched her second collection for kids on Tuesday (March 16) for Gap store. A few kids modelled designer outfits being entertained with balloon animals, jelly and cake and a robot photo shoot booth.

The items of the new range include: stripey knits, denim shirts, flowery jackets and checked jackets.
Describing the collection Stella said:
I think this collection has a mix of the playful and practical. It’s a reflection of my brand, there are pieces that are classic and very sort of timeless and hopefully very chic, and then there are pieces that are the kind you chuck in the washing machine and they get better with time and, you know, they are funny and hopefully a little bit cool.”
Designer claims it was important for her to create pieces that would make every child individual.
She explained:
For this second collection I wanted to design pieces that ensure your child looks like an individual with their own style statement, a mixture of simple minimal styles and more detailed pieces to create a summer wardrobe for all your kids’ needs.”
Marka Hansen, President of Gap brand said:
We’re pleased and encouraged by the response to our first collection working with Stella. The combination of her unique aesthetic and our brand’s experience in childrenswear has resonated with our customers around the world, with certain styles including the Miller jacket being a sellout success. We’re thrilled to be working with Stella on a Spring collection.”
The new collection is set to debut in stores the week of March 22nd.
